@ -246,8 +245,6 @@ public class DispatcherServlet extends FrameworkServlet {
@@ -246,8 +245,6 @@ public class DispatcherServlet extends FrameworkServlet {
/** Additional logger to use when no mapped handler is found for a request. */
@ -838,17 +835,15 @@ public class DispatcherServlet extends FrameworkServlet {
@@ -838,17 +835,15 @@ public class DispatcherServlet extends FrameworkServlet {
@ -928,8 +923,7 @@ public class DispatcherServlet extends FrameworkServlet {
@@ -928,8 +923,7 @@ public class DispatcherServlet extends FrameworkServlet {
@ -1114,15 +1108,15 @@ public class DispatcherServlet extends FrameworkServlet {
@@ -1114,15 +1108,15 @@ public class DispatcherServlet extends FrameworkServlet {
@ -1203,9 +1197,8 @@ public class DispatcherServlet extends FrameworkServlet {
@@ -1203,9 +1197,8 @@ public class DispatcherServlet extends FrameworkServlet {
"Could not resolve view with name '"+mv.getViewName()+"' in servlet with name '"+
getServletName()+"'");
thrownewServletException("Could not resolve view with name '"+mv.getViewName()+
"' in servlet with name '"+getServletName()+"'");
}
}
else{
@ -1226,8 +1219,8 @@ public class DispatcherServlet extends FrameworkServlet {
@@ -1226,8 +1219,8 @@ public class DispatcherServlet extends FrameworkServlet {
}
catch(Exceptionex){
if(logger.isDebugEnabled()){
logger.debug("Error rendering view ["+view+"] in DispatcherServlet with name '"
+getServletName()+"'",ex);
logger.debug("Error rendering view ["+view+"] in DispatcherServlet with name '"+
getServletName()+"'",ex);
}
throwex;
}
@ -1295,8 +1288,6 @@ public class DispatcherServlet extends FrameworkServlet {
@@ -1295,8 +1288,6 @@ public class DispatcherServlet extends FrameworkServlet {
logger.debug("Restoring snapshot of request attributes after include");
// Need to copy into separate Collection here, to avoid side effects
// on the Enumeration when removing attributes.
Set<String>attrsToCheck=newHashSet<String>();
@ -1316,18 +1307,20 @@ public class DispatcherServlet extends FrameworkServlet {
@@ -1316,18 +1307,20 @@ public class DispatcherServlet extends FrameworkServlet {
for(StringattrName:attrsToCheck){
ObjectattrValue=attributesSnapshot.get(attrName);
if(attrValue==null){
if(logger.isDebugEnabled()){
logger.debug("Removing attribute ["+attrName+"] after include");